Gulbieniszki
Gulbieniszki is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Jeleniewo, within Suwałki County, Podlaskie Voivodeship, in north-eastern Poland. According to the 1921 census, the village had a population of 173, entirely Polish by nationality and Roman Catholic by confession.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Suwałki Landscape Park
Nature reserve

Suwałki Landscape Park is a protected area in north-eastern Poland, established in 1976, covering an area of 62.84 square kilometres. The area of the park is 6337.66 ha, of which approximately 60% is arable land, 10% water, 24% forests and trees, 4% marshy areas, and 2% other land. Suwałki Landscape Park is situated 3½ km west of Gulbieniszki.
